Cancel Plant Parent - Guida alla Cura on iPhone (iOS)
- 1Open the Settings app on your iPhone or iPad.
- 2Tap your name at the top of the screen to open your Apple ID.
- 3Tap Subscriptions to see every app that bills you through Apple.
- 4Find Plant Parent - Guida alla Cura in the list and tap it. If it is not there, you may have subscribed through the app itself or a different Apple ID.
- 5Tap Cancel Subscription and confirm. You keep access to Plant Parent - Guida alla Cura until the current billing period ends, then it will not renew.
Cancel Plant Parent - Guida alla Cura on Android
- 1Open the Google Play Store app on your Android device.
- 2Tap your profile icon, then Payments & subscriptions, then Subscriptions.
- 3Select Plant Parent - Guida alla Cura from your list of subscriptions.
- 4Tap Cancel subscription and choose a reason when prompted.
- 5Confirm the cancellation. Uninstalling Plant Parent - Guida alla Cura on its own does not stop billing, you must cancel the subscription here.
How to get a refund for Plant Parent - Guida alla Cura
Canceling stops future renewals but does not refund a charge you already paid. Request the refund from the store separately.
Go to reportaproblem.apple.com, sign in with your Apple ID, find the Plant Parent - Guida alla Cura charge, choose Request a refund, pick a reason and submit.
Open the Play Store, go to your order history, select the Plant Parent - Guida alla Cura purchase, tap Report a problem and request a refund. Requests within 48 hours are often auto-approved.

Plant Parent - Guida alla Cura cancellation: frequently asked questions
Does canceling Plant Parent - Guida alla Cura stop the charges immediately?
No. Canceling stops future renewals but you keep access until the end of the billing period you already paid for. After that date Plant Parent - Guida alla Cura will not charge you again. If you were charged unexpectedly, request a refund separately.
Can I get a refund from Plant Parent - Guida alla Cura?
Refunds are handled by Apple or Google, not by Plant Parent - Guida alla Cura directly. On iPhone, go to reportaproblem.apple.com, sign in, find the Plant Parent - Guida alla Cura charge and choose Request a refund. On Android, open the Play Store order history, select the purchase and tap Report a problem. Requests made within 48 hours are often approved automatically.
Why is Plant Parent - Guida alla Cura still charging me after I canceled?
The most common causes: the cancellation did not finish (check that Subscriptions shows Plant Parent - Guida alla Cura as Expired), you have a second subscription under a different Apple ID or Google account, or you canceled inside the app but not in the store where billing actually lives.
